Can the Nuvo Essentia even be controlled via IR? I'm hoping for basic IR or 232 control, one-way is fine, just need basic zone on/off and volume. Source select would be cool but not essential.
I check yahoo groups, crestron site, and Nuvo's site for a module or at least document and couldn't find. I'm not sure if I looked in the right place on the Nuvo Site. I'm going to check the RTI mega list next.

I know you can control zones through the keypads with IR but don't know of an IR input on the amplifier itself. Have used RS-232 in the past with URC and worked fine.
